Noor Zaman storms into Optasia Championships quarter-finals
ISLAMABAD, 27 March (BelTA - APP) - Pakistan’s Noor Zaman delivered an
impressive performance to reach the quarter-finals of the Optasia
Championships in England, a Gold-level event offering a prize purse of
US $130,000.
The tournament, being held from March 24 to 29, has
attracted top-ranked players from around the world, but Noor Zaman stood
out with a commanding display in his second-round encounter.
Facing
Mexico’s Leonel Cardenas, who is ranked World No. 14 and seeded eighth
in the tournament, Noor Zaman, currently World No. 31, produced a
clinical performance to secure a straight-games victory, according to
information made available here by Pakistan Squash Federation.
Noor won the match 3-0 with game scores of 11-7, 11-5, and 11-7 in 32 minutes.
From
the outset, Noor dictated the pace of the match with aggressive
shot-making and tight control, giving his higher-ranked opponent little
opportunity to settle. His consistency and precision proved decisive as
he comfortably closed out all three games without conceding momentum.
With
this victory, Noor Zaman has advanced to the quarter-finals, where he
is set to face a formidable challenge against Peru’s Diego Elias, the
World No. 3.
